Understanding the All-Inclusive Promise

Opusvirtualoffices.com emphasizes its “all-inclusive” package, detailing specific services covered: layinsun.com Alternatives

  • Prestigious Business Address: Critical for establishing credibility and legal registration.
  • Professional Live Call Answering: Ensures no calls are missed and provides a polished first impression.
  • Personalized Call Transferring: Directs calls efficiently to the right person or department.
  • Business Phone/Fax Number: Separates personal and professional communication.
  • Professional Mail Receipt: Centralized handling of correspondence.
  • Voicemail/Fax Converted to Email: Modernizes communication and improves accessibility.

These services collectively aim to replicate the functions of a physical office without the associated costs, offering significant value to remote and growing businesses.
